What is Windows security Task Manager?

Security Task Manager is designed to detect all tasks and processes running on a computer and can alert you to any potential security risks. The program is designed by Neuber in Germany.

What is a security task?

Security Task Manager is a shareware program for Microsoft Windows devices that ranks running processes based on an algorithm that determines the security risk of each process. … The program is compatible with Windows XP and newer versions of Windows.

What is the task manager?

What is Task Manager? Task Manager shows you the programs, processes, and services that are currently running on your computer. You can use Task Manager to monitor your computer’s performance or to close a program that is not responding.

What happens if you end everything on Task Manager?

Stopping processes with high-resource usage While stopping a process using the Task Manager will most likely stabilize your computer, ending a process can completely close an application or crash your computer, and you could lose any unsaved data.

What happens if I end system task?

But what happens if you end Windows Explorer in the Task Manager? As it turns out, terminating Windows Explorer will not only close any open File Explorer windows, but it will also render the Start menu, Taskbar, and System Tray unusable.

What should Chrome Task Manager do?

With Chrome’s Task Manager open, you can see a list of every open tab, extension, and process. You can also view key statistics concerning how much of your computer’s memory it is using, the CPU usage, and network activity. … The screen also displays the memory footprint for each process.
